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Very_Strong

The NM_001182.5(ALDH7A1):c.328C>T(p.Arg110Ter) variant causes a stop gained change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000471 in 1,613,902 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★★). Synonymous variant affecting the same amino acid position (i.e. R110R) has been classified as Likely benign.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

Genes affected
ALDH7A1 (HGNC:877): (aldehyde dehydrogenase 7 family member A1) The protein encoded by this gene is a member of subfamily 7 in the aldehyde dehydrogenase gene family. These enzymes are thought to play a major role in the detoxification of aldehydes generated by alcohol metabolism and lipid peroxidation. This particular member has homology to a previously described protein from the green garden pea, the 26g pea turgor protein. It is also involved in lysine catabolism that is known to occur in the mitochondrial matrix. Recent reports show that this protein is found both in the cytosol and the mitochondria, and the two forms likely arise from the use of alternative translation initiation sites. An additional variant encoding a different isoform has also been found for this gene. Mutations in this gene are associated with pyridoxine-dependent epilepsy. Several related pseudogenes have also been identified. [provided by RefSeq, Jan 2011]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ingRady Children's Institute for Genomic Medicine, Rady Children's Hospital San DiegoNov 02, 2017The p.Arg119Ter variant (also referred to as p.Arg82Ter in the literature) is a stop-gained variant that is predicted to result in the premature truncation of the ALDH7A1 protein. This variant has been reported in two patients, once in the homozygous state and once in the compound heterozygous state that is identical to that seen in this patient (PMID: 16491085). This variant combination was shown to result in an absence of enzyme activity via in vitro functional expression studies in Chinese hamster ovary cells (PMID: 16491085). The highest reported allele frequency in the population database, gnomAD, is 0.0001 (13/126702 alleles). Based on the available evidence, the p.Arg119Ter variant is classified as pathogenic.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eDec 22, 2023This sequence change creates a premature translational stop signal (p.Arg110*) in the ALDH7A1 gene. It is expected to result in an absent or disrupted protein product. Loss-of-function variants in ALDH7A1 are known to be pathogenic (PMID: 16491085, 20554659). This variant is present in population databases (rs121912708, gnomAD 0.01%). This premature translational stop signal has been observed in individuals with pyridoxine-dependent seizures (PMID: 16491085, 18717709, 26101365, 26232297). This variant is also known as c.244C>T, p.Arg82X.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 17995). For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ingAmbry GeneticsMar 28, 2022The c.328C>T (p.R110*) alteration, located in exon 4 (coding exon 4) of the ALDH7A1 gene, consists of a C to T substitution at nucleotide position 328. This changes the amino acid from a arginine (R) to a stop codon at amino acid position 110. This alteration is expected to result in loss of function by premature prot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. Based on data from gnomAD, the T allele has an overall frequency of 0.01% (18/282868) total alleles studied. The highest observed frequency was 0.01% (1/7222) of Other alleles. This alteration has been reported in the homozygous and compound heterozygous states in multiple individuals with pyridoxine-dependent epilepsy (Cirillo, 2015; Kingsmore, 2019; Mills, 2006; Tincheva, 2015). Based on the available evidence, this alteration is classified as pathogenic. -
